27 //! A framework to define display of 3D chamfers.
28 //! A chamfer is displayed with arrows and text. The text
29 //! gives the length of the chamfer if it is a symmetrical
30 //! chamfer, or the angle if it is not.
31 class PrsDim_Chamf3dDimension : public PrsDim_Relation
33 DEFINE_STANDARD_RTTIEXT(PrsDim_Chamf3dDimension, PrsDim_Relation)
36 //! Constructs a display object for 3D chamfers.
37 //! This object is defined by the shape aFShape, the
38 //! dimension aVal and the text aText.
39 Standard_EXPORT PrsDim_Chamf3dDimension(const TopoDS_Shape& aFShape, const Standard_Real aVal, const TCollection_ExtendedString& aText);
41 //! Constructs a display object for 3D chamfers.
42 //! This object is defined by the shape aFShape, the
43 //! dimension aVal, the text aText, the point of origin of
44 //! the chamfer aPosition, the type of arrow aSymbolPrs
45 //! with the size anArrowSize.
46 Standard_EXPORT PrsDim_Chamf3dDimension(const TopoDS_Shape& aFShape, const Standard_Real aVal, const TCollection_ExtendedString& aText, const gp_Pnt& aPosition, const DsgPrs_ArrowSide aSymbolPrs, const Standard_Real anArrowSize = 0.0);
48 //! Indicates that we are concerned with a 3d length.
49 virtual PrsDim_KindOfDimension KindOfDimension() const Standard_OVERRIDE { return PrsDim_KOD_LENGTH; }
51 //! Returns true if the 3d chamfer dimension is movable.
52 virtual Standard_Boolean IsMovable() const Standard_OVERRIDE { return Standard_True; }
56 Standard_EXPORT virtual void Compute (const Handle(PrsMgr_PresentationManager3d)& aPresentationManager, const Handle(Prs3d_Presentation)& aPresentation, const Standard_Integer aMode = 0) Standard_OVERRIDE;
58 Standard_EXPORT virtual void ComputeSelection (const Handle(SelectMgr_Selection)& aSelection, const Standard_Integer aMode) Standard_OVERRIDE;
